  4. Yale University Press is the university press of Yale University. It was founded in 1908 by George Parmly Day and Clarence Day , grandsons of Benjamin Day , and became a department of Yale University in 1961, but it remains financially and operationally autonomous.

Yale University Press, one of the oldest and largest independent presses in the country, was founded in 1908 and publishes across a wide range of disciplines, with titles for the trade, the classroom, the professional and the teacher. Popular categories are history, biography, science, the humanities, and art, architecture, photography and fashion.
